Instant Mawa / Khoya

Instant Mawa / Khoya

Mawa / Khoya / khoa is a dairy product widely used to make curries and sweets in  South Asian Cuisine. Mawa / khoya is made by thickening the milk, that takes a lot of time and effort. If you are in rush, try out this instant mawa / khoya recipe which tastes exactly like real mawa / khoya.
Preparation Time : 2 minutes
Cooking Time : 15 minutes
Ingredients : 
  1. Milk - 300 ml
  2. Milk Powder - 100 grams
  3. Clarified Butter / Ghee - 2 tablespoon
Steps :
1. Here are all the ingredients. Use the milk at room temperature.
2. Heat a pan and add clarified butter / ghee on low flame and let it melt (do not heat the clarified butter / ghee).
NOTE: You can use unsalted butter instead of clarified butter / ghee.
 
3. Add milk in the melted butter and mix well till milk and clarified butter / ghee gets mixed. Let the milk starts boiling.
4. Add milk powder and mix till it gets smooth and lump free.
5. The mixture is lump free and smooth. Put the heat on low-medium and cook the mixture. Stir continuously to avoid any lump or burns.
6. After 6-7 minutes of cooking, the mixture starts getting thick.
7. After 12 minutes of cooking, the mixture will turn into saucy consistency, keep stirring the mixture.
8. After 15 minutes of cooking, the mixture will starts separating from the sides and starts to collect.
 9. Once the mixture starts to form dough like consistency, turn off the heat and let it cool down.
10. Take out the khoya / mawa in a bowl, make your favorite sweets or dish with this instant mawa / khoya.
